About
LAVA North Summer Program offers multi-day camps, skills workshops, clinics, youth development classes, stand-alone clinics, training pods, bi-weekly workshops, youth programs, position academies, club volleyball, and beach training. The program also includes cross-training on beach for indoor players and youth and juniors development programs for both girls and boys.
• Ages: 8–18 years old
• Schedule: The Summer Program at LAVA North includes all offerings in June, July, and August that are not part of the club volleyball season, with options such as one-day skill clinics (75–90 minutes), multi-day half-day or full-day camps (2–5 hours), multi-week training pods and youth programs, and bi-weekly workshops that meet two days per week for 75 minutes per day.
LAVA North has been successfully serving the Santa Clarita community since 2011, and the Los Angeles Volleyball Academy (LAVA) was established in 2010. The organization is a youth and juniors club volleyball organization for girls and boys with multiple locations in and around Los Angeles and fields more than 100 teams annually across age divisions for girls ages eight to eighteen. SMBC Boys Volleyball Club, established in 1982, is one of the oldest volleyball clubs for boys in the country and fields almost twenty teams annually across age divisions for boys age ten to eighteen. The Beach Program offers elite club-level beach training, cross-training on beach for indoor players, and youth and juniors development programs for girls through LAVA Beach and for boys through SMBC Beach.
The LAVA North Summer Program is based out of an exclusive three-court facility. LAVA North leadership includes LAVA North Director Sia Irilian, Beach Director David Callis, and former Olympian and AVP professional Casey Patterson, with club leadership and key administrators including Nabil Mardini (Director, Principal), Sheldon Sheehy (Billing Manager), Candice Tunis (Registrations Manager/Travel Coordinator), Trevor Julian (Director, Principal), and Samantha Calisto (Recruiting Director). According to its mission statement, LAVA’s primary goal is to develop the finest youth and junior athletes and coaches in the region, with an emphasis on talent, technical mastery, volleyball acumen, competitiveness, work ethic, mental toughness, and passion for the game, and it states that it is built around notions of family, loyalty, dedication, and reliability and that it strives to develop quality female athletes and remarkable young women.
